    For those who have windows and linux, and perhaps 2 HDDs also.

    How do you do the installation of the OS's and why. Do you pull the windows HDD out and install linux on its own? Or do you leave the windows drive in so that linux recognizes theres another OS and setup a boot manager? If so do you install windows first then linux or the other way around?

    One disadvantage of the former is that you have to fix the time in linux not to use UTC, or else logging back and fourth messes the windows time. The disadvantage (or advantage) is there is no nice menu to choose between OSes and you will hjave to initiate the bios boot order to load the correct OS.

    i dont mean you have to enter bios every time, although perhaps some crap bioses you may have to. but you can invoke commands like f12, f11 whatever it is to load the boot list.

    try installing windows on one HDD. pull that out. Install linux on another HDD. put both in. log into windows, then log into linux, then log back into windows, and you might find your time messed up. Linux uses the UTC time standard whereas windows uses bios time.

    A first google search result:

    http://osdir.com/ml/org.user-groups.linux.uk.peterboro/2007-08/msg00052.html

    when u install linux with windows already, the setup normally by default fixes this so you wont observe this problem by changing the linux time standard to not use utc. if you installed them separate, then you might.

    The way it seems to work for me, is always leaving both drives in and installing Windows first. See, Windows' bootloaders doesn't give a crap about Linux, but GRUB, installed with most linux distros these days, can easily set the correct parameters to boot Windows as well. Thus, install Windows first, then Linux. GRUB will overwrite the bootloader of windows and take command of booting whatever OSes you want.

    It doesn't matter what you install first. You can edit GRUB or the BCD to get a dualboot system. You just have to keep track of what's controlling your MBR.
